A visit to Berry College in Rome, Georgia is always a pleasure and a chance for some photo opportunities. Berry is not your usual campus, with a huge wildlife refuge area, a equine area with acres and acres of beautiful horses, ponds, fabulous buildings, an old grist mill, and even an eagles nest. One of my favorite spots is Frost Chapel, set high on a hill and backed by woods. On this summer day, the colors of the surrounding area provided a nice contrast with the more neutral stone construction of the building. This lovely arched and beamed breezeway is part of the exterior. I loved the repeating patterns of the stone pillars, beams, and lanterns that all serve to provide a welcoming entry path.
